Suppression and enhancement of the Aspergillus nidulans medusa mutation by altered dosage of the bristle and stunted genes.
Genetics - 1 May 1996
Busby T M, Miller K Y, Miller B L
Abstract excerpt
Asexual reproduction in Aspergillus nidulans is characterized by the orderly differentiation of multicellular reproductive structures (conidiophores) and chains of uninucleate conidia (spores).
